Price List for Breast Volume Reduction Surgery in Albany

The cost of breast volume reduction surgery in Albany can vary depending on multiple factors such as the complexity of the surgery, the surgeon's fee, anesthesia fees, hospital fees, and additional costs for post - operative care. Here are some average price estimates from different clinics:

At K Plastic Surgery

The approximate price for breast reduction at K Plastic Surgery is $12,500. There is a $500 scheduling fee when booking the surgery, which is non - refundable and will be deducted from the surgical cost estimate. The balance of the payment is due at the pre - operative appointment or 3 weeks before surgery. Other incidental fees may include those for a physician assistant, garments, and lab work.

At Deluca Plastic Surgery

For breast reduction, the surgeon fees range from $4,000 to $8,400. However, additional fees and expenses such as an anesthesiologist's fee, surgery center/hospital operating room fee, implants (if any), prescriptions, pre - op clearance and lab work, compression garments, and travel costs can contribute to the total cost of the surgery. A consultation with Dr. Deluca, Dr. Tauber, or Dr. Yan is necessary for an accurate estimate based on the patient's surgical goals.

At Rockmore Plastic Surgery

The general price range for breast reduction at Rockmore Plastic Surgery is $9,500 to $11,000. Their pricing includes routine office visits, plastic surgeon's fees, anesthesia, operating room fees, and post - op care. But prescription medications, lab work (if necessary), and certain post - surgical garments are not included. Specific pricing requires a personal consultation with Dr. Jeffrey Rockmore.

At K Plastic Surgery (Alternative Pricing)

Another source from K Plastic Surgery shows that the price for breast reduction ranges from $8,000 to $9,500 with a recovery time of 1 - 2 weeks.

Clinic Price Range Additional Information
K Plastic Surgery $8,000 - $12,500 $500 scheduling fee, incidental fees for PA, garments, lab work; recovery 1 - 2 weeks
Deluca Plastic Surgery $4,000 - $8,400 Additional fees for anesthesia, OR, implants etc.; consultation needed for accurate estimate
Rockmore Plastic Surgery $9,500 - $11,000 Price includes office visits, surgeon fees, anesthesia, OR fees, post - op care; exclude meds, lab work, some garments

Factors Influencing the Price

The complexity of the surgery is a major factor. If the patient has a very large breast size, significant sagging, or other anatomical issues, the surgery may be more complex and time - consuming, leading to a higher cost. The reputation and experience of the surgeon also play a role. Highly - regarded and experienced surgeons may charge more for their services. The location of the surgery, whether it is in a large hospital or a private clinic, can also affect the price. Additionally, the type of anesthesia used and the length of the hospital stay can contribute to the overall cost.

What to Expect Before, During, and After Breast Volume Reduction Surgery

Before the Surgery

As with any surgical procedure, proper preparation is essential. You will have a consultation with your chosen surgeon, during which you should openly discuss your goals, medical history, and any concerns you may have. If you are a smoker, it is highly recommended to stop smoking at least 6 weeks before and 6 weeks after the surgery, as smoking can impede the healing process. You may also need to stop taking certain medications, such as aspirin and non - steroidal anti - inflammatory drugs, as they can increase the risk of bleeding. In some cases, pre - surgical weight loss may be necessary, especially if your BMI is higher than 32, to reduce the risk of complications.

During the Surgery

Breast volume reduction surgery is usually performed under general anesthesia, which means you will be asleep during the procedure. The surgeon will make incisions on your breasts, and the specific type of incision will depend on factors such as the size of your breasts, the degree of sagging, and the position of your nipple - areolae. The most common incision is the anchor incision, which follows the natural contours of the breasts. The surgeon will then remove excess skin and breast tissue, reshape the breasts, and reposition the nipple - areola complex. In some cases, drains may be placed to remove excess fluid, and the incisions are closed with dissolvable sutures and skin glue.

After the Surgery

After the surgery, you will be wrapped in a padded dressing for a short period, followed by a surgical bra. You can expect some discomfort and tenderness, which can be managed with pain medication. Drains, if placed, will usually be removed within a day or two. You will need to sleep on your back with your torso elevated to reduce swelling and pressure on your breasts. It is important to follow your surgeon's post - operative instructions carefully, which may include limiting physical activity, keeping the incision area clean, and attending follow - up appointments. While the initial recovery period may take a few weeks, it may take several months for the final results to fully显现. Some swelling and bruising may persist for a while, and the scars will gradually fade over time.

Benefits and Risks of Breast Volume Reduction Surgery

Benefits

One of the most significant benefits of breast volume reduction surgery is the relief of physical discomfort. Many patients experience a reduction in back pain, neck pain, and shoulder pain, as well as a decrease in skin irritation under the breasts. The surgery can also improve posture and make it easier to engage in physical activities. From a psychological perspective, it can boost self - confidence and body image, allowing patients to feel more comfortable in their own skin. Additionally, finding clothes that fit properly becomes much easier after the surgery.

Risks

Like any surgical procedure, breast volume reduction surgery carries some risks. There is a risk of reaction to anesthesia, which can range from mild to severe. Infection is another potential risk, although this can be minimized by following proper post - operative care instructions. Bleeding during or after the surgery is also possible, and in some cases, may require additional treatment. There is a risk of permanent numbness of the skin or nipple - areola complex, which can affect sensation. Poor - quality scars and wound - healing problems may also occur. However, these risks are relatively rare, especially when the surgery is performed by a qualified and experienced surgeon.

Choosing the Right Surgeon for Breast Volume Reduction Surgery in Albany

Selecting the right surgeon is a crucial step in ensuring a successful breast volume reduction surgery. Here are some factors to consider:

  • Credentials: Look for a board - certified plastic surgeon. Board certification indicates that the surgeon has met certain standards of education, training, and experience in plastic surgery. For example, a surgeon certified by the American Board of Plastic Surgery has undergone rigorous training and testing.
  • Experience: Find out how many breast volume reduction surgeries the surgeon has performed. A surgeon with a significant number of successful cases is likely to have more refined skills and be better prepared to handle any potential complications.
  • Patient Reviews: Read reviews from previous patients to get an idea of the surgeon's bedside manner, the quality of care provided, and the overall satisfaction of the patients. You can find these reviews on online platforms or ask the surgeon for patient testimonials.
  • Before - and - After Photos: Request to see before - and - after photos of the surgeon's previous breast reduction patients. This will give you an idea of the potential results and the surgeon's aesthetic skills.
  • Communication: During the consultation, pay attention to how well the surgeon communicates with you. A good surgeon will take the time to listen to your concerns, explain the procedure in detail, and answer all your questions.
